Add … Web1 mrt. 2024 · The operating cost includes the cost of goods sold (COGS). Aside from COGS, operating costs also include the other operating expenses that are often called selling, general, and administrative (SG & A). Those three cover rent, payroll, overhead cost, as well as raw materials and other maintenance costs.

Web23 mrt. 2024 · Key Takeaways. Insurance, license fees, rent, property taxes, and travel expenses are common examples of operating expenses. An increase in operating expenses means less profit for a business.
